Vices are those behaviors that lead to self-inflicted pain and misery for ourselves and those around us. But some vices hit different—they're vici capitali, deeply entrenched and toxic to the soul. This course will illuminate the psychological aspects of these heavyweights and provide a plethora of insights into the seven deadlies:
-
Superbia (Pride) 🏅
- The proud individual often exhibits arrogance and belittles others' achievements. But beneath the facade, they harbor doubts about their own abilities, fearing that any failure or exposure of inadequacy would reveal the truth: they're not as exceptional as they pretend to be.
-
Accidia (Sloth) 🛑
- The sluggard is content with idleness and neglects responsibilities, rationalizing that it's no big deal and won't lead to dire consequences. But make no mistake, procrastination is a vicious cycle!
-
Lussuria (Lust) 💫
- Lust isn't just about indulging in sensual pleasures. It's about being held captive by fantasies and cravings that divert your attention from daily responsibilities. Keep it PG, folks!
-
Ira (Wrath) 🔥
- Wrath is more than occasional anger. It's an extreme reactivity where even minor irritations can trigger explosive rage.
-
Gola (Gluttony) 🍽️
- Gluttony isn't merely overeating or feasting on luxury foods. It's about having a refined palate that craves and justifies an exclusive diet of expensive, exquisite cuisine.
-
Invidia (Envy) 🤫
- The envious person can't stand when others succeed. They often attribute the happiness of others to luck or injustice, feeling personally slighted by their joy.
-
Avaritia (Greed) 💰
- Greed isn't just about being frugal out of necessity; it's about taking pleasure in hoarding and saving for the sheer love of it. The greedy often label themselves as wise, thrifty, or cautious to justify their miserly ways.
